What Is a Low Profile Mechanical Keyboard?
A low profile mechanical keyboard is created to use the gratifying feel and toughness of mechanical switches in a slimmer and much more compact package. Traditional mechanical key-boards have buttons with a higher actuation point and even more traveling distance, giving that acquainted "clicky" or responsive comments numerous users enjoy. Nonetheless, they likewise have a tendency to be bulky and hefty.
Low profile variations are engineered with much shorter buttons and a thinner chassis, offering a much reduced inputting elevation. This causes:
Decreased key traveling
Faster actuation
A lighter and a lot more streamlined layout
A more ergonomic typing angle
Regardless of being slimmer, low profile mechanical keyboards still offer that costs mechanical feel. They're often preferred by people that want transportability and performance without endangering on develop quality or convenience.

What to Look for in a Low Profile Mechanical Keyboard.
When buying a low profile mechanical keyboard, below are a few features to consider:.
Change Type: Do you like straight, responsive, or clicky buttons? See to it your selection offers the typing feel you're used to.
Build Material: Look for sturdy materials like aluminum if you want resilience and a premium feel.
Backlighting: RGB or white backlighting includes design and presence in low-light settings.
Connection: Choose in between wired, cordless, or Bluetooth choices depending upon exactly how and where you prepare to use it.
Form Factor: Decide whether you want a full-size keyboard with a number pad or a more compact 60%, 75%, or TKL (tenkeyless) variation.
